Dinamo Riga wins LDZ Kauss
In the final of LDZ Kauss on Wedneseday the Latvian hosts Dinamo Riga won against their KHL rivals Lokomotiv Yaroslavl with 3-1 in Arena Riga. Just one day earlier Lokomotiv had won the last group match between the two teams with 4-1. Finnish SM-liiga side Espoo Blues took the third place after defeating Atlant Mytischy 3:2 in the shootout. The following awards were given to the best players of LDZ Kauss.
Tournament MVP: Karsums (Riga); Best Goalie: Jučers (Riga), Best Defender: Vishnevsky (Atlant), Best Forward: Kalyuzhny (Lokomotiv)
